Health Condition / Problems Studied  
Health Type  Condition 
Healthy Human Volunteers  Caregivers of Persons Living with Schizophrenia 
 
Intervention / Comparator Agent  
Type  Name  Details 
Comparator Agent  Psychoeducation  2 sessions of psychoeducation would be given to Control Group. 
Intervention  Solution-Focused Brief Intervention  Focused group discussion(FGD) with the experts and in-depth case studies with the caregivers of schizophrenia will be done. Intervention will be developed after the findings from FGD group and case study group. 3 to 4 sessions of FGD would be conducted with the experts and in-depth case study will have 1 session with the every caregivers. 
 
Inclusion Criteria  
Age From  18.00 Year(s)
Age To  60.00 Year(s)
Gender  Both 
Details  1. Caregivers of Schizophrenia
2. Age Range: 18 to 60 years
3. Duration of illness: 3 years and above
4. Person who can speak Hindi and English
5. The primary caregivers who are directly involved and stay with the patient can be anyone Eg: Parents, Siblings, or Extended family members.
 
 
ExclusionCriteria 
Details  1. Caregivers who are having a severe psychiatric disorder
2. Caregivers with intellectual disabilities.
